use crate::{CreatedDelta, Diffable, Patchable};
use std::borrow::{Borrow, Cow};
impl<'s, 'e, 'a, T> Diffable<'s, 'e, Cow<'a, T>> for Cow<'a, T>
where
T: ToOwned,
T: ?Sized,
T: Diffable<'s, 'e, T>,
{
type Delta = <T as Diffable<'s, 'e, T>>::Delta;
type DeltaOwned = <T as Diffable<'s, 'e, T>>::DeltaOwned;
fn create_delta_towards(&'s self, end_state: &'e Cow<'a, T>) -> CreatedDelta<Self::Delta> {
let inner_self: &T = self.borrow();
inner_self.create_delta_towards(end_state.borrow())
}
}
impl<'s, 'e, 'a, T> Patchable<<Self as Diffable<'s, 'e, Self>>::DeltaOwned> for Cow<'a, T>
where
T: ToOwned,
T: ?Sized,
T: Diffable<'s, 'e, T>,
<T as ToOwned>::Owned: Patchable<<T as Diffable<'s, 'e, T>>::DeltaOwned>,
{
fn apply_patch(&mut self, patch: <T as Diffable<'s, 'e, T>>::DeltaOwned) {
self.to_mut().apply_patch(patch)
}
}
